read the excerpt from act 2 of a dolls house.
nora: that letter is from krogstad.
mrs. linde: nora—it was krogstad who lent you the money!
nora: yes, and now torvald will know all about it.
mrs: linde: believe me, nora, thats the best thing for both of you.
nora: you dont know all. i forged a name.
mrs. linde: good heavens—i
nora: i only want to say this to you, christine—you must be my witness.
mrs. linde: your witness? what do you mean? what am i to—?
nora: if i should go out of my mind—and it might
which statement best describes the conflict?
○ nora has accused krogstad of forging her name on the loan she received from him, and threatens to expose him.
○ nora has forged her fathers name on the loan she received from krogstad, and he is threatening to expose her to helmer.
○ nora fears that she will go out of her mind, and she needs mrs. lindes promise that she will help when the time comes.
○ mrs. linde refuses to understand the severity of noras problem between her and her husband and will not help her.

Explanation:

Brief Explanations

The excerpt reveals Nora took a loan from Krogstad by forging her father's name, and she fears Krogstad will expose this to her husband Torvald (Helmer). The other options are incorrect: Nora did not accuse Krogstad of forgery, her fear of losing her mind is a secondary concern not the core conflict, and Mrs. Linde does not refuse to help her.

Answer:

Nora has forged her father's name on the loan she received from Krogstad, and he is threatening to expose her to Helmer.
